A Word DOC konvertálása Markdown-ra a NET REST API segítségével

Ez a rövid útmutató segít megérteni, hogyan lehet a Word DOC-ot NET REST API-val leértékelésre konvertálni a felhőben. A DOC MD formátumba való exportálásához Aspose.Words for .NET Cloud SDK-t használunk. Ha érdekli a Word leértékelés átalakítása a C# Low Code API-ban, hajtsa végre ezt a feladatot a megadott mintakóddal és lépésekkel.

Előfeltétel

Lépések a Word Markdown-ra konvertálásához a NET REST API segítségével

  1. Állítsa be a kliensazonosítót és az ügyféltitkot az API-hoz az MD-re való átalakításhoz
  2. Hozzon létre egy objektumot a WordsAPI osztályból az ügyfél hitelesítő adataival
  3. Adja meg a bemeneti és kimeneti fájlokat
  4. Olvassa be a bemeneti DOC fájlt, és mentse bájttömbbe
  5. Példányosítsa a ConvertDocumentRequest() metódust a fenti bájttömb segítségével
  6. Hívja a ConvertDocument metódust a DOC konvertálásához MD-vé a REST API használatával
  7. Mentse a kimeneti MD fájlt a helyi lemezre

Kód DOC konvertálásához MD-vé C# REST API-val

using Aspose.Words.Cloud.Sdk;
using Aspose.Words.Cloud.Sdk.Model.Requests;
using System;
using System.IO;
namespace WordsSample.Words
{
public class WordsToMd
{
public void ConvertWordToMdAsync()
{
try
{
var apiClient = new Configuration();
apiClient.ClientSecret = "Client Secret";
apiClient.ClientId = "Client ID";
//Create SDK object
WordsApi wordsApi = new WordsApi(apiClient);
//string localPath = @"";
string inputFile = "Test1.doc";
string outputFile = "DOCXToMD";
string outputFormat = "md";
//Read input file to bytes array
var inpuFileStream = File.Open(inputFile, FileMode.Open);
inpuFileStream.Position = 0;
ConvertDocumentRequest convertDocumentRequest = new ConvertDocumentRequest(inpuFileStream, outputFormat, null, null, null, null, null, null, null);
var conversionTask = wordsApi.ConvertDocument(convertDocumentRequest);
conversionTask.Wait();
var outputFileStream = conversionTask.Result;
outputFileStream.Position = 0;
using (var fileStream = File.Create(outputFile+"."+ outputFormat))
{
outputFileStream.Seek(0, SeekOrigin.Begin);
outputFileStream.CopyTo(fileStream);
}
}
catch (Exception e)
{
Console.WriteLine(e.Message);
}
}
}
}

A fenti mintakódrészlet lehetővé teszi, hogy DOC-t MD-vé konvertáljon C# REST API-val. Be kell vinnie egy DOC-fájlt az Aspose.Words REST API SDK for C# segítségével, és le kell töltenie a kimeneti MD-fájlt, hogy helyileg mentse az Aspose online konverziós API használatával. A ConvertDocumentRequest metódus különféle konfigurációkat tesz lehetővé, például fájltárolást az egyéni betűtípusokhoz, jelszavakat a védett Word-fájlok visszafejtéséhez, a bemeneti TXT- és HTML-fájlok kódolási részleteit, valamint a forrásdokumentum tárolását.

Ez a DOC-MD konvertálás bármely kód nélküli vagy alacsony kódú alkalmazással használható Windows, Linux vagy Mac rendszeren.

Megnézhet egy másik hasonló funkciót is a következő oldalon: Hogyan konvertálja a DOC-t EPUB-ba a NET REST API-val.

 Magyar